The country’s first and — perhaps still only — exclusively online Catholic university is marking its 35th anniversary this year, a testament to the role it continues to play in the landscape of Catholic higher education. Marianne Mount, the president of Catholic Distance University (CDU), said the anniversary has focused the school’s attention on its distinctive mission and identity. “Now, in the words of Pope Francis, the CDU is able to reach the peripheries,” Mount said. Catholic Distance University was founded in 1983 by Bishop Thomas Welch of the Diocese of Arlington, Virginia, who recognized a need for the formation of the laity after Vatican II’s teachings on the universal call to holiness and witnessing to Christ in the world.
